Redo Problem 6.12 with the Soave–Redlich-Kwong equation of state.
Problem 6.12
Ethylene at 30 bar and 100°C passes through a heaterexpander and emerges at 20 bar and 150°C. There is no flow of work into or out of the heater-expander, but heat is supplied. Assuming that ethylene obeys the Peng-Robinson equation of state, compute the flow of heat into the heater-expander per mole of ethylene
